The pituitary gland is located inside a round bony cavity that is separated from the

sphenoid sinus by a thin bone that forms the roof of the sphenoid sinus. The sphenoid
sinus is the most posterior sinus. The drainage from the sphenoid is almost directly down
the throat from an ostium (hole) that opens into the posterosuperior part of the nasal
cavity. The sphenoid sinus is adjacent to the main nerve that is responsible for vision, the
optic nerve. The main artery that goes to the brain, the carotid artery, travels along the
wall of this sinus.
Also nerve impulses from the eyes and ears pass through the colliculi with the pineal
directly overhead separated by CSF. Thus secretions from the pineal would have a direct
impact on the colliculi. The colliculus is part of the brain that sits below the thalamus
and surrounds the pineal gland. It is involved in the generation of eye movements and
hand-eye coordination. The colliculus receives visual, as well as auditory inputs, and its
deeper layers are connected to many sensorimotor areas of the brain. The colliculus as a
whole is thought to help orient the head and eyes toward something seen or heard.

The pineal produces melatonin and serotonin. The amino acid percursor of serotonin
(5-hydroxytryptamine, 5-HT) is tryptophan. Adequate levels of vitamin B6 are necessary
for the synthesis of serotonin. Within the pineal gland, serotonin is acetylated and then
methylated to yield melatonin. The highest density of melatonin receptors are found in
the suprachiasmatic nucleus of the hypothalamus, the anterior pituitary and the retina.
Melatonin is a hormone that communicates information about light and entrains
biological rhythms including sleep-wake cycles and reproduction. The light-transducing
ability of the pineal gland is why some call it the "third eye." Melatonin inhibits the
secretion of the gonadotropic hormones luteinizing hormone and follicle stimulating
hormone from the anterior pituitary. Much of this inhibitory effect seems due to
inhibition of gonadotropin-releasing hormone from the hypothalamus.

CIRUMVENTRICULAR ORGANS
The term circumventricular organs refers to the highly-vascularized, specialized tissues
distributed principally along the midline of the ventricular system from the forebrain to
the hindbrain, bordering the 3rd and 4th ventricles. The CVO's include the pineal gland,
median eminence, neurohypophysis (posterior pituitary), subfornical organ, area
postrema, subcommissural organ, organum vasculosum of the lamina terminalis, and the
choroid plexus. The intermediate and neural lobes of the pituitary are sometimes
included and note the posterior pituitary releases neurohormones like oxytocin and
vasopressin into the blood.
The subcommissural organ contacts the third ventricle covering the posterior
commissure. It comprises a complex of neurosecretory ependymal cells known to secrete
various glycoproteins into the CSF. The functional significance of these glycoproteins

has not yet been determined. Except for the SCO all the circumventricular organs lack a
blood-brain barrier and are recognized as important sites for communicating with the
CSF, and between the brain and peripheral organs via blood-borne products. They have a
high capillary density and it is through the CVO's that the brain is able to monitor the
makeup of the blood. They all contact the cerebrospinal fluid of the ventricles or
subarachnoid space. These organs have common morphological and endocrine-like
characteristics that distinguish them from the rest of the nervous system and neural
connections with strategic nuclei establishing circuitry for communications throughout
the neuraxis.
CEREBROSPINAL FLUID
Ventricles are hollow cavities within the brain that produce CSF from their lining
(choroid plexus). The choroid plexus consists of many capillaries, separated from the
subarachnoid space by pia mater and choroid ependymal cells. Liquid filters through
these cells from blood to become CSF. There is also much active transport of substances
into, and out of, of the CSF as it's made. CSF normally contains no red or white blood
cells and little protein; all constituents of CSF are resorbed, including small molecules,
proteins and microorganisms. There is a higher concentration of most molecules in the
brain than in the CSF, this creates a chemical gradient between the two compartments.
CSF allows for distribution of neuroactive substances, and is the "sink" that collects
wastes produced by the brain: the main ones being C02, lactate and excess hydrogen
ions (H+). It also serves as a heat sink.
CSF itself is clear and colorless, and contains small amounts of protein, glucose,
potassium and relatively large amounts of sodium chloride. CFS passes through
ventricles and into the fourth ventricle from which it escapes into the subarachonoid
space through the median and lateral apertures. From there it circulates via hydrostatic
pressure through the subarachonoid cisterns at the base of the brain, and then is directed
up over the hemispheres and down around the spinal cord, flowing down to about the
second sacral vertebrae. After it is reabsorbed into venus sinus blood via arachnoid villi;
note that arachnoid villi become hypertrophied and calcified with age (arachnoid
granulations). Arachnoid villi are small protrusions of the arachnoid (the thin second
layer covering the brain) through the dura (the thick outer layer). They protrude into the
venous sinuses of the brain, and allow cerebrospinal fluid (CSF) to exit the brain, and
enter the blood stream. The arachnoid villi act as one-way valves. Normally the pressure
of the CSF is higher than that of the venous system, so CSF flows through the villi and
granulations into the blood. It has been suggested that the endothelial cells of the venous
sinus create vacuoles of CSF, which move through the cell and out into the blood.
The CSF is moved under the influence of hydrostatic pressure generated by its
continuous production and its circulation allows for homeostasis of the environment that
surrounds the brain. CSF movement allows arterial expansion and contraction by acting
like a spring, which prevents wide changes in intracranial blood flow. It is expected that
the brain tissue and the CSF would have the same hydrostatic pressure in any part of the

brain. The cerebrospinal fluid fills the cavity of the ventricles and the subarachnoid
spaces. The subarachnoid space extends caudally around the spinal cord and ends in
lumbar-sacral dural sac where it surrounds the cauda equina. The lining of the tube is
composed of ependymal cells and cili, the beating of which is required for normal CSF
flow. Cilliated cells are common throughout the respiratory and genital tracts and also in
the tympani-the cartilaginous and bony margins of auditory tube, Eustachian tube
connecting the back of the nose to the middle ear and ventricals of the brain.
The fluid is made at the rate of 21ml/hr is completely changed every 6-7 hours. It is
believed that CSF takes one to two hours to reach the basal cisterns, 3 to 4 hours to reach
the sylvian fissure and 10 to 12 hours to spread over the cerebral subarachnoid space. By
24 hours it started to be cleared into the superior sagittal sinus.
